How Does Online Booking Compare With Manual Scheduling?
Manual scheduling usually requires both practitioner and client to be available at some point in the same communication loop. A client sends an email, text, or message, the practitioner checks availability, suggests a time, and waits for confirmation.
Online scheduling moves more of that process into a self-service workflow. Clients can view available appointment times and choose an option without requiring the practitioner to manually coordinate every step.
A systematic review of web-based medical appointment systems found that many implementations reported positive changes in measures such as staff labor, waiting time, no-show rates, and satisfaction. However, researchers also identified barriers including cost, flexibility, safety, and system integration, meaning online scheduling is not automatically better in every setting.

4. Reduce No-Shows with Automated Reminders
Research provides stronger evidence for appointment reminders than for many of the other statistics commonly cited about online booking. A systematic review and meta-analysis involving more than 16,000 patients found that people receiving electronic text notifications were 23% more likely to attend appointments than those receiving no notification. No-shows occurred among 15% of patients receiving notifications compared with 21% receiving none.
The review also found that multiple notifications were more effective than a single notification, suggesting that reminders can be an important component of a broader booking workflow rather than simply an optional convenience.

The Heallist Perspective: Booking Shouldn't Create More Work
At Heallist, we see online booking as more than putting a calendar on your website. The real value comes from connecting the steps around the appointment.
When scheduling happens manually, a simple booking can involve several messages: checking availability, confirming a time, collecting payment, sending reminders, and updating your calendar. Each step is small, but repeated across clients, it adds administrative work to the practice.
A more connected workflow allows practitioners to define their availability and services while giving clients a clearer way to request and manage appointments. Booking, payment, reminders, and practice management can then work together rather than functioning as separate tasks.
The goal isn't to remove practitioner control. It's to automate the repetitive parts of scheduling while keeping practitioners in control of their availability and client experience.

What if I still want some control over my schedule? Can I approve bookings manually?
Most online booking systems allow you to set specific availability, require pre-approval for appointments, or block off time manually. This ensures you maintain full control over your schedule while still benefiting from automation.
